About this opportunity
The NASA Postdoctoral Program (NPP) offers unique research opportunities to highly-talented scientists to engage in ongoing NASA research projects at a NASA Center, NASA Headquarters, or at a NASA-affiliated research institute. These one- to three-year fellowships are competitive and are designed to advance NASA's missions in space science, Earth science, aeronautics, space operations, exploration systems, and astrobiology. This specific opportunity focuses on developing methods of data analysis for an emerging VLBI+GNSS technique, identifying areas of strengths and weaknesses of the new technique, optimizing observing programs, processing data, and presenting evidence that substantiates claims about strengths and weaknesses. Recent advances in space geodesy instrumentation and data analysis have allowed the blurring of lines between very long baseline interferometry (VLBI) and global navigation satellite systems (GNSS) techniques, enabling observations of GNSS satellites with VLBI, use of GNSS receivers as VLBI array elements, and determination of pseudo-ranges from voltage data of GNSS satellites recorded with radio telescopes. This is a new research area categorized as high risk, high reward. NASA heavily contributes to the ongoing international geodetic VLBI observing program for determination of terrestrial coordinate system, celestial coordinate system, and determination of the Earth orientation parameters with the highest accuracy.
